Skillibeng keeps momentum rolling with new single ‘Nobody’
Jamaican dancehall star Skillibeng has released his latest single, “Nobody,” continuing his strong run of music in 2026.
The song arrived on July 10, 2026, through Droptop Records. Rowan “Droptop Records” Melhado produced the track, Topalonee created the beat, and Shane Creative directed the official music video.
A confident new release
“Nobody” delivers the gritty trap-dancehall sound that has become a trademark of Skillibeng’s recent releases.
Throughout the song, Skillibeng celebrates success, wealth and persistence. He also reminds listeners that his journey is different from everyone else’s. One of the standout lines, “no man nuh dweet like we,” reinforces the song’s central message of confidence and individuality.
Meanwhile, the production keeps a heavy rhythm that matches Skillibeng’s signature delivery. As a result, the record maintains high energy from start to finish.
The official music video
The official music video reflects the themes heard throughout the song.
Directed by Shane Creative, the visual combines luxury vehicles, street scenes and performance shots. Together, these elements create a polished look while staying true to the record’s gritty dancehall style.
Skillibeng’s strong 2026 run
“Nobody” arrives during another busy year for the Jamaican deejay.
Earlier this year, Skillibeng completed his 20-city North American “Badman She Love Tour” alongside Moliy. Since then, he has continued releasing music and expanding his international audience.
In addition, he has collaborated with Koffee, Shenseea and Ayetian on several notable releases.
His breakout hit “Crocodile Teeth” also continues to reach new milestones. The record has now surpassed 75 million YouTube views and 55 million Spotify streams.
